扫码订阅《 》或
入驻星球
,即可阅读文章!
在此填写券码订阅!
订阅
GOLANG ROADMAP
阅读模式
沉浸
自动
日常
首页
Go学习
Go学院
Go小课
Go小考
Go实战
精品课
Go宝典
在线宝典
B站精选
推荐图书
精品博文
Go开源
Go仓库
Go月刊
Go下载
视频资源
文档资源
Go求职
求职服务
内推互助
求职助力
求职刷题
企业题库
面试宝典
求职面经
Go友会
城市
校园
推广返利 🤑
实验区
Go周边
消息
更多
用户中心
我的信息
推广返利
玩转星球
星球介绍
角色体系
星主权益
支持与服务
联系星主
成长记录
常见问题
吐槽专区
合作交流
渠道合作
课程入驻
友情链接
扫码订阅《 》或
入驻星球
,即可阅读文章!
在此填写券码订阅!
订阅
21.Mysql中查询数据什么情况下不会命中索引?
GOLANG ROADMAP
Mysql中查询数据什么情况下不会命中索引?
通常不命中索引有接种情况:
索引规范不合理,sql解析器不命中索引.
表中索引是以表中数据量字段最多的建立的索引,sql解析器不命中索引.(实际就是索引没用,最后全局查找了)
bool的字段做索引,sql选择器不命中索引.
模糊查询 %like
索引列参与计算,使用了函数
非最左前缀顺序
where对null判断
where不等于
or操作有至少一个字段没有索引
需要回表的查询结果集过大(超过配置的范围)